As virus cases drop, Virginia plans to loosen restrictions
May 6, 2021 GMT
RICHMOND, Va. (AP) Virginia could lift capacity limits and relax rules for social distancing next month if the rate of coronavirus infections continues to fall in the state, Gov. Ralph Northam said Thursday.
The state’s tentative plan is to loosen those restrictions on June 15 and allow businesses such as theaters and yoga studios to operate at full capacity.
Northam said Virginia still needs to evaluate a possible change in the future to its mandate for wearing masks, with the state most likely continuing to follow guidance from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
